Notes About The Poem

In May of this year, I was on a week long cycling trip in Mallorca . On  the Monday morning, I was sitting having a coffee out front of a hotel in Port De Pollenca, while waiting to link up with my other cycling companions.

  . As I sat there  the melody of the Leonard Cohen song, A Thousand Kisses Deep, played over the sound system. Being a lover of all things music and the songs of Leonard Cohen, the combination of the  May morning sunshine, the Medetterrian  seascape, and a  day of leisure cycling that lay ahead, made it into one of those rare perfect moments you experience in your life from time to time..

Nothing Blue about this Monday


What  a way to begin the week,
A crystal blue sky reflected in a Mediterranean sea.
A Thousand Kisses Deep by Leonard Cohen,
The melody that is, not the words
Waft out from the speaker 
Of the beach front hotel
In Port de Pollenca, Mallorca.

I'm biding my time, gazing onto the calm
With, coffee and treat.
There's nothing blue about this Monday
An unexpected moment of,
Bliss and solitude
Takes hold
Where everything is perfect
 In a sometimes, imperfect world.

The trumpet players lips caress the melody
of; A Thousand Kisses Deep.
Sending  out its waves onto a 
Blue Mediterranean bay.

Then a text bleeps,
'Leaving in five.'
I arise, take up my bike and walk
In step and on the right note 
For the day ahead.
